How to make plotly charts adjust to page width using rmarkdown?


I have an R blog post with some leaflet and plotly figures. I can set width = "100%" in the leaflet() function, and the leaflet map will change shape as I resize my browser window (or view on mobile). I've tried the same width = "100%" in plot_ly(), but the plot doesn't resize for smaller windows and requires horizontal scrolling.

Any ideas? I'm using blogdown/hugo if that is helpful.


Solution

  • Use the chunk option:

    ```{r, out.width='100%'}
